The Department of Occupational and Environmental Health at the Hudson College of Public Health, University of Oklahoma Health Campus, invites applications for a full-time, tenure-track faculty position at the rank of Assistant or Associate Professor in the discipline of Environmental Health with a research focus on measurement, characterization, and control of exposures to microbiological and/or chemical agents in water. We are seeking an outstanding candidate whose work integrates advanced laboratory techniques to address one or more of the following focus areas:
- Environmental exposures linked to cancer outcomes,
- Military and defense-related environmental exposures,
- Environmental health concerns of Native American populations and tribes,
- Children’s environmental health, and/or
- Water, food, and air quality impacts on population health.
